许疃煤矿3238风巷过老空水探放孔洞治理技术

Treatment Technology of Water Exploration and Drainage Hole Passing Through Goaf in 3238 Air Roadway of Xutuan Coal Mine

摘要 下区段巷道沿空掘进期间,必须对老空水进行超前集中探放。钻机压力与静水压力的耦合作用对沿空侧煤体扰动破坏性强,钻孔内排出大量的煤屑,产生诸多不规则孔洞,导致瓦斯、煤层自燃及水害事故。先后采取超前探查、调整层位、注浆加固及管理保障措施后,实现了沿空巷道安全快速过老空水探放孔洞,保证了矿井安全生产。 During the driving along goaf of lower section roadway,the gob water must be detected and released in advance.The coupling effect of drilling machine pressure and hydrostatic pressure has a strong destructive effect on the disturbance of coal body along the goaf side.A large number of coal chips are discharged from the borehole,resulting in many irregular holes,resulting in gas,coal spontaneous combustion and water damage accidents.After taking the measures of advanced exploration,adjustment of horizon,grouting reinforcement and management guarantee measures,the gob side roadway can safely and quickly pass through the old goaf water exploration and drainage hole,and ensure the safety production of the mine.
